And because I'm a nerd for these things, here's some more history on this spelling. It did come from 'lead' but was a way to differentiate it's meaning from a different type of 'lead' (and pronunciation; rhymes with dead) which is the strip of metal that would separate lines of type. 'lede' didn't enter Merriam-Webster until 2008.
